webfact Posted May 8, 2017 Share Posted May 8, 2017 Pap Secret: Thai hospital gives masks to women embarrassed about getting Pap smear By Coconuts Bangkok Photo: TipcableTV KAMPHAENG PHET: -- The women who received a free Pap smear test at a hospital in Kamphaeng Phet province last week didn’t need to feel embarrassed about getting an absolutely normal medical check, because they could hide behind creepy green masks. This head-scratching initiative, called “The Mask Pap Smear,” was started by Sa Kaew sub-district office and the Nong Krot Hospital, to decrease the awkwardness between the doctors and patients who are shy about getting a gynecological exam. The project was targeted at women aged 30-70.
